Common injuries from a trucking accident
Trucking accidents can cause serious and life-threatening injuries. Burns, fractures and lacerations are just a few of the frequent injuries.
Burns can be extremely severe and may cause permanent scars. Burns can also make the victim more susceptible to infections. They can also be difficult to treat. Many burn victims have to undergo numerous surgical procedures.
Another common trucking injury is the spinal cord injury. These injuries can lead to paralysis. Many sufferers suffer from ligament injuries, muscle strains and tendon injuries.
Bone fractures are also quite common. Based on the extent of the accident, some fractures will not heal. Others may require surgery and traction. Bone fractures can lead to infection, bleeding, and deformity.
In addition to physical consequences there are people who suffer psychological trauma as a result of physical pain. Traumatic brain injury is one of the most tragic injuries that can occur in the event of a trucking accident. It can result in memory loss and cognitive impairment.

Internal injuries may be the result of any crash. The survivors of a trucking crash can experience internal bleeding. A spleen injury, bladder, and kidneys can be extremely dangerous.
Brain injuries that cause trauma are quite common. Although the injury may not be apparent right away symptoms may include loss of cognitive function, memory hearing, reasoning, and even hearing. People who have suffered traumatic brain injuries may also experience seizures.
